The accommodation itself features a mix of room types designed to cater to different student needs. First-year students are assigned rooms randomly, each equipped with a sink, while shared bathrooms and kitchens are located at the end of the corridors. For third-year students, there are self-contained flats available, which can be chosen through a random ballot process. This variety in accommodation styles ensures that students can find a living arrangement that suits their preferences, whether they enjoy the communal experience of shared living or the independence of a flat.

πŸ’‘ Things to Know

  • The Junior Common Room serves free biscuits and tea at 11am and 4pm, fostering a communal atmosphere.
  • First-year students are assigned rooms randomly, so be prepared for a surprise.
  • Third-year students can choose flatmates through a random ballot process.
  • Accessibility features are available; refer to the dedicated Access Guide for more information.
  • Expect a mix of relaxed and lively vibes depending on the resident community.
